TX-Kw: An Effective Temporal XML Keyword Search

Author 1: Rasha Bin-Thalab
Author 2: Neamat El-Tazi
Author 3: Mohamed E.El-Sharkawi

Download PDF

Digital Object Identifier (DOI) : 10.14569/IJACSA.2013.040630

Article Published in International Journal of Advanced Computer Science and Applications(IJACSA), Volume 4 Issue 6, 2013.

  • Abstract and Keywords
  • How to Cite this Article
  • {} BibTeX Source

Abstract: Inspired by the great success of information retrieval (IR) style keyword search on the web, keyword search on XML has emerged recently. Existing methods cannot resolve challenges addressed by using keyword search in Temporal XML documents. We propose a way to evaluate temporal keyword search queries over Temporal XML documents. Moreover, we propose a new ranking method based on the time-aware IR ranking methods to rank temporal keyword search queries results. Extensive experiments have been conducted to show the effectiveness of our approach.

Keywords: temporal XML; Keyword Search; ranking
